WebModern jawless fishes are divided into two classes: lampreys and hagfishes. Lampreys • Filter feeders • Adult’s head is completely taken up by a circular sucking disk with a round jawless mouth in the center • Live by attaching themselves to fishes and scraping away at the skin with their large teeth and a strong tongue • Then suck ... "Gnathos" is Greek for "jaw" and the prefix "a" means "without," so agnathans are "without jaws.
